Basketball Play - Florida Gulf Coast Eagles WBB - Curl UCLA Rip

Florida Gulf Coast Eagles WBB - Curl UCLA Rip

Matt Wheeler 02/08/2022

The Florida Gulf Coast Eagles women's team is known for their five-out offense and three-point shooting but this is a great quick-hitting play that they run to get a lob for their 5. The play starts with the guards curling around the posts at the elbows followed by a UCLA cut by the point guard and they 5 popping out to receive the pass from 3. 5 then reverses to 4 to setup the decoy action of 2 cutting off a screen from 1. 3 then sets the backscreen for 5 on the weakside for the lob. Basketball Play - Flat Rise Stagger Backdoor

Flat Rise Stagger Backdoor

Matt Hackenberg 01/28/2022

In this diagram and embedded video we look at a baseline out of bounds play to set up a backdoor. The set uses a stagger screen to distract the defense, and misdirection to isolate a single defender for the backdoor. Basketball Play - Princeton Offense - Multi-Option Set: "Hawk"

Princeton Offense - Multi-Option Set: "Hawk"

Matt Hackenberg 12/12/2021

This is a long form play with multiple options from a Princeton alignment and a floppy action to feature a dynamic player. If the player can drive, shoot, post up, finish off the cuts or use a ball screen there are options to do so. We used the play to feature a shooter, but a post up player or a driver could also be used, just different options would need to be emphasized. Basketball Play - Quick Hitter: Box Overload Duck

Quick Hitter: Box Overload Duck

Matt Hackenberg 11/23/2021

Any time we had a functional big man, we always have this in the playbook. The play is simple, and provides a great opportunity to isolate your big. The movement puts the defense in a tough spot because the back side help is removed, so if they front, we can throw over the top for a layup. If they play behind, we have a 1 on 1 opportunity on the block. The play gets right to the point of the set, which I like because it limits the number of ball handlers and decisions that need to be made. You can easilty hide weaker players in the 4 or the 2 spot in this play. Basketball Play - Miami Heat - Flat Ram Exit

Miami Heat - Flat Ram Exit

Dave Nedbalek 10/19/2021

This is a simple exit set utilizing a 1-4 low alignment. The clip included shows the set as designed but there are several other components I like about this set as well. With Morris (ideally Adebayo would be here) sprinting up off Herro's brush screen into a simple touch and out middle ball screen there is a component of rim pressure being applied here as well. The Heat do not, but I would lift our weakside guard (Strus) to occupy the tag and place him in a long closeout. You also have the slip, or post feed after the pinscreen for the shooter coming out. Basketball Play - Zone Flash Double

Zone Flash Double

KJ Smith 08/08/2021

ALWAYS pass to the side where x3 is and 4 will follow to that corner 1 exchanges with 2 as the ball is reversed to the opposite wing Reversal 5 down screens 4 to flash to the nail or top of the key 2 and 3 space away to weakside wing and corner 3 Reads: Lob to 5, Pass to 4, or skip to 2/3 See More

Basketball Play - Zone Flash Single

Zone Flash Single

KJ Smith 08/08/2021

Ball ALWAYS goes to side where X3 is located. 4 will follow to that corner to receive the pass. 4 pass to 3, 3 pass to 2 and cut to opposite corner. 5 down screen for 4 looking to flash to the nail or 3 point line. 1 fades to space in the corner. 3 reads: lob to 5, skip to 1, or 4 can shoot/look high-low.
